Dennis Paul Showalter II, 46

Posted on Monday, March 30, 2026 at 8:04 am

 

 

Dennis Paul Showalter II, 46 passed away on Thursday, March 24. He was born in Madison Heights, Michigan and later made his home in Jasper, where he built a life centered around his family and community.  Dennis was a devoted husband to his wife Valerie Showalter, with whom he shared 26 happy years of marriage with, and a proud father to his three sons Dennis, Michael, and Landen Showalter.

His family was the most important part of his life and he was deeply committed to providing for them and supporting them in everything they did.  He worked as the store general manager at CVS Pharmacy in Jasper, where he was known for his strong work ethic, leadership and reliability.  In addition to his career, Dennis also served his community as a volunteer firefighter with the Jasper Fire Department, demonstrating his willingness to help others and put others before himself.  Dennis was a passionate football fan who loved supporting his local teams, Marion County and Sewanee, and was a loyal fan of the Detroit Lions.  Dennis will be remembered for his dedication to his family, his service to his community, and the steady presence he provided to those around him.  He will be deeply missed by all who knew and loved him.
